Output 86654ada10955d26d276fc69a59d3c28ca33ad1890f175472185c315d4336c68:1

value
21924578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06e255f0dffaea06a1ca47fe7d619f57df9213af OP_EQUAL
address
32KR7mvUs4j67d5B3bZNaLTNTEvxYsqUnq
transaction
86654ada10955d26d276fc69a59d3c28ca33ad1890f175472185c315d4336c68
confirmations
463785
spent
true